About this property
Country living in the city! Enjoy peace, privacy, and room to breathe in this charming 1,442 sq. ft. home situated on 1.66 acres in Dickinson. Featuring 3 bedrooms and 2 baths, this home offers bamboo flooring throughout, granite countertops in the kitchen, and baths, custom cabinetry with soft-close drawers, a pot filler, and stainless steel appliances. The spacious primary suite includes a large walk-in closet and private bath with glass-enclosed shower and separate soaking tub. Updates include roof (2021), A/C (2023), double-pane windows, and water softener/filtration system (2023). Exterior construction is low maintenance Hardiplank. City water adds convenience while the acreage provides a true country feel. Outside, you'll find large covered RV parking and a storage shed with plenty of room for your toys, tools, and outdoor projects. A rare opportunity to enjoy acreage living while staying close to city conveniences!

Learn About the Market: Opportunity in Texas




Explore
Texas
Living in Texas means access to four of the nation’s most dynamic metro economies — Dallas–Fort Worth’s corporate and logistics powerhouse, Houston’s global energy and medical hub, Austin’s tech-driven and culturally iconic Live Music Capital of the World, and San Antonio’s historic yet steadily expanding military and healthcare center. The state blends economic scale with cultural significance, rooted in independence, entrepreneurship, and a strong sense of place — from Friday night football to world-renowned barbecue and music festivals. For homebuyers, Texas offers comparatively attainable housing, no personal income tax, and master-planned communities built around space and convenience; for investors, continued population growth, business relocation, and diversified industries create sustained demand across urban cores, suburbs, and emerging secondary markets.
